ASSOCIATE DEGREE PROGRAMS

The college awards the Associate in Science (A.S.) and Associate in Applied Science (A.A.S.) degrees.

Course substitutions, where appropriate and necessary, may be made upon the approval of the designated academic officer.

NOTE: Enrollment in other than registered or otherwise approved programs may jeopardize a student's eligibility for certain awards.

 

The college currently offers online degree programs in Business Administration (A.A.S.), Criminal Justice (A.S. Hospitality Management (A.A.S.), Information Technology (A.A.S.), and Medical Administration (A.A.S.) and a variety of courses in other majors which are taught in either the "Blended Learning" (a combination of online and onsite sessions) as well as online format.

Note: Degree candidates who do not possess a high school credential must complete the following courses to be eligible for the New York State 24-credit GED: six credits in English Language Arts, including writing, speaking, and reading (literature); three credits in Mathematics; three credits in Natural Science; three credits in Social Science; three credits in Humanities; and six credits in the major program.
